## Local setup

Repro for the Quillgate session-token refresh bug (tokens expiring mid-request after rotation). Clone the repo, install deps, run the auth service with the stub identity provider. Hit the refresh endpoint twice within the rotation window to trigger the 401. Token rows must be inspected directly to confirm the stale signature. Point your client at the dev database using the string below.

replica DSN, kajep-yahag: mssql://praok_svc:iF@db-8d68.plorvaio.local:5432/eliion

## Transporting tour props
Quick guide for the records team. Props for the Lanternjaw Theatre tour move in sealed road cases via Greywick Freight. Always log case numbers before release and snap a photo of each seal — saves arguments later. Fragile cases get the orange tag; those ride last-on, first-off. When the driver arrives, check their run sheet, then give them the confidential instruction below.

courier memo of yawep-yafog: the pramir ulaix courier leaves the ulavan aldix frair zorok oliiel joreth rusdor fenvan ledger at gate 1305 under passcode 514738

### Flaky Integration Tests — Tollgate Payments Service

Several Tollgate integration tests intermittently fail when the sandbox settlement simulator cold-starts. Before cutting a release, warm the simulator by running the smoke suite twice and discarding the first result. The suite authenticates against the internal Ledgerline verification service, and runs will fail immediately without valid credentials. The current credential for that service appears below.

app token of bahaf-tajeg = zpat23_SjjsllwiLmXbtS65veZaV47

Hey support folks — quick note on where the monthly fleet fuel-usage report actually comes from, since tickets keep asking. The report is generated by the Haulwick pipeline, which pulls odometer and pump data from the Torveld depot feeds nightly, then rolls it up every first Monday. If a customer disputes numbers, check whether their depot synced that week before escalating. The PDF itself is stamped by our signing step, so you can always verify which build produced it. The trace token for the current release is right here.

build token for kagaf-hahof: htk14_9d3d4d26d7d8de